社区
MS-SQL Server
帖子详情
SQL server中的primary key的问题?
easydone
2000-05-18 08:22:00
SQL server中建表,能否在一个表中同时设置多个字段都为主键?如果能,请您指教我应该怎么做?
...全文
199
5
打赏
收藏
SQL server中的primary key的问题?
SQL server中建表,能否在一个表中同时设置多个字段都为主键?如果能,请您指教我应该怎么做?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
5 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
tanghuan
2000-05-18
打赏
举报
回复
经你们提醒,我误解了问题意思。
主键多列和多个主键不同
主键多列是可以的
halfdream
2000-05-18
打赏
举报
回复
当然可以的。在多对多关系转化成的表中常可以用到。
主键跟索引是两回事。尽管主键常常是聚簇索引。
zhengmj
2000-05-18
打赏
举报
回复
可以,设置时,选中你要设置成主键的列(可用Shift键选中多列),然后点击设置主键的按钮(Key),即可。
sutao
2000-05-18
打赏
举报
回复
当然可以,同时选中几个字段,设为主键即可。
tanghuan
2000-05-18
打赏
举报
回复
不能,因为主键是集簇索引,不能有多个
如果你需要多个主键,可以设一个为主键
其余为唯一索引
SQL
Server
之
PRIMARY
KEY
约束
1、在表
中
常有一列或多列的组合,其值能唯一标识表
中
的每一行,这样的一列或多列成为表的主键(
Primary
Key
)。 2、一个表只能有一个主键,而且主键约束
中
的列不能为空值。 3、只有主键列才能被作为其他表的外键所...
SQL
学习之
primary
key
约束
目录参考源
SQL
primary
key
约束
primary
key
create table 时的
SQL
primary
key
约束My
SQL
/
SQL
Server
/ Oracle / MS Accessalter table 时的
SQL
primary
key
约束My
SQL
/
SQL
Server
/ Oracle / MS Access删除 ...
SQL
Server
Primary
Key
和Clustered Index
在创建Table设定主键的时候,
SQL
Server
会自动创建一个对应的Clustered Index。如果使用Microsoft
SQL
Server
Management Studio工具,发现这个Clustered Index只能删除,不能通过界面进行修改。这让人误以为在主键...
SQL
Server
中
的约束:
SQL
NOT NULL,UNIQUE和
SQL
PRIMARY
KEY
This article explains the
SQL
NOT NULL, Unique and
SQL
Primary
Key
constraints in
SQL
Server
with examples. 本文通过示例解释
SQL
Server
中
SQL
NOT NULL,唯一和
SQL
主键约束。 Constraints in
SQL
...
SQL
Server
中
有五种约束,
Primary
Key
约束、Foreign
Key
约束、Unique约束、Default约束和Check约束
SQL
Server
中
有五种约束,
Primary
Key
约束、Foreign
Key
约束、Unique约束、Default约束和Check约束,今天使用
SQL
Server
2008来演示下这几种约束的创建和使用的方法。1、
Primary
Key
约束 在表
中
常有一列或多列的组合...
MS-SQL Server
34,576
社区成员
254,587
社区内容
发帖
与我相关
我的任务
MS-SQL Server
MS-SQL Server相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章